Transaction 58951b6e774ba1701d60684dc5539c86f5bacc80b95993b21af95bd032815ed6
1 Input
1 Output
-
58951b6e774ba1701d60684dc5539c86f5bacc80b95993b21af95bd032815ed6:0
- value
- 2859795
- script pubkey
- OP_0 OP_PUSHBYTES_20 335c3759421fe9e0f479e572bc03bf214d83b129
- address
- bc1qxdwrwk2zrl57pareu4etcqaly9xc8vff2s86u5